Under the and the Cinematograph (Amendment) Act, 2023 , the downloading, streaming, or sharing of pirated content is a serious criminal offense. The law holds not just the uploaders but also the consumers accountable. Penalties can be severe: a person caught downloading or sharing pirated films can face imprisonment of up to three years and fines that can reach ₹3 lakh or more, potentially up to 5% of the film's production budget in some cases. Furthermore, viewing pirated content on such sites is not anonymous; authorities and anti-piracy agencies have sophisticated methods like IP tracking and website monitoring to trace offenders.

Upon its release on April 1, 2022, Idiot received mixed to negative reviews. While some fans of Shiva enjoyed the senseless humor, many critics felt the writing was thin and the jokes repetitive. Reviewers from The Times of India noted that the film was a "below average" addition to the horror-comedy genre that lacked fresh sensibilities. Where to Watch
